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

Three.js

Three.js is a cross-browser JavaScript library and Application Programming Interface (API) used to create and display animated 3D computer graphics in a web browser.

https://github.com/ethanlchristensen/threejs_pathfinder

A web-based path finding visualizer using threeJS

pathfinding threejs visualization

Last synced: 12 Oct 2024

https://github.com/edwmurph/threejs

Minimal boilerplate code for a project with three.js + React + GatsbyJS + Bootstrap

bootstrap gatsbyjs react threejs

Last synced: 17 Jan 2025

https://github.com/rmdnps10/atc2024

<코끼리를 냉장고에 넣는 방법> 2024 Art Technology Conference Official Website

interactive nextjs threejs

Last synced: 01 Nov 2024

https://github.com/cyrus2281/night-city

3D website game featuring cyberpunk-themed city filled with easter-eggs and references to the developers' life

3d cyberpunk game-engine night-city portfolio threejs website-game

Last synced: 06 Nov 2024

https://github.com/riachx/spcwby

3D Website for the Santa Cruz based collective Space Cowboy.

react react-three-drei react-three-fiber react-three-postprocessing threejs website

Last synced: 27 Nov 2024

https://github.com/alexp11223/three.js_guardedcastle

Three.js scene. Castle with textures, guard models.

animation graphics learning threejs

Last synced: 06 Feb 2025

https://github.com/wkaisertexas/wkaisertexas.github.io

My portfolio site built as a Static Site using Astro and Deployed to GitHub pages

astro portfolio tailwindcss threejs

Last synced: 15 Nov 2024

https://github.com/overrevvv/portfolio

portfolio website, work in progress!

javascript nuxi nuxt3 nuxtjs tailwindcss threejs tresjs vue

Last synced: 17 Jan 2025

https://github.com/teddy55codes/blochsphere

Interactive bloch sphere implemented with Three.js

bloch-sphere complex-numbers quantum-computing qubit threejs

Last synced: 20 Nov 2024

https://github.com/solrachix/apple

Apple product presentation page with 3d products

3dmodels apple landing-page next react swiper threejs

Last synced: 13 Nov 2024

https://github.com/joshwrn/portfolio

my old portfolio site from 2021

framer-motion portfolio react reactjs styled-components threejs

Last synced: 20 Nov 2024

https://github.com/joshwrn/doodleverse

DoodleVerse is a realtime multiplayer drawing game built with Next.js, socket.io, and React Three Fiber.

nextjs react react-three-fiber socket-io threejs

Last synced: 21 Jan 2025

https://github.com/bozzhik/threejs

usage example of three.js

3d-animation onscroll threeasy threejs

Last synced: 23 Jan 2025

https://github.com/kicshikxo/kicshikxo-site

Мой личный сайт-портфолио на Nuxt 3

maxwell nuxt3 portfolio-website threejs typescript wtfpl

Last synced: 01 Feb 2025

https://github.com/dragonir/panorama-basic

全景漫游-基础版

3d panorama threejs

Last synced: 13 Nov 2024

https://github.com/iyinchao/three-css3d

Yet another typescript port of Three.js CSS3DRenderer, with small tweaks and enhancements.

css-transforms css3d css3d-renderer dom renderer threejs typescript

Last synced: 18 Nov 2024

https://github.com/scorpionknifes/degeneracy

Miku dance using three-vrm

three-fiber threejs vrm

Last synced: 18 Nov 2024

https://github.com/glintonliao/threejs-template-typescript

Starting template of Three.js projects based on TypeScript and Vite

pnpm threejs typescript vite

Last synced: 25 Jan 2025

https://github.com/jgphilpott/polyplot

A data exploration application inspired by Ola Rosling's Trendalyzer software.

d3js data-exploration data-science ola-rosling threejs trendalyzer

Last synced: 21 Nov 2024

https://github.com/riachx/scrollable-glass-page

3D Scrolling Interactive Webpage

3d animation meshtransmissionmaterial threejs

Last synced: 19 Jan 2025

https://github.com/angydev/threejs-offset

Create an offset sets of points or an offset mesh from an STL file

3d javascript threejs threejs-example threejs-learning

Last synced: 21 Nov 2024

https://github.com/choaib-elmadi/portfolio-design-1

A 3d portfolio with some awesome animations and user select configurations, implemented using vite with react.js and three.js

javascript portfolio react threejs vite

Last synced: 22 Nov 2024

https://github.com/choaib-elmadi/3d-portfolio

3D portfolio implemented using react, vite, threejs, react-three/fiber and react-three/drei.

3d javascript portfolio react threejs vite

Last synced: 22 Nov 2024

https://github.com/fernanda-kipper/ray-marching-scene

This repository contains a simple 3D scene built using WebGL and Ray Marching Technique

ray-marching threejs webgl webgl2

Last synced: 12 Jan 2025

https://github.com/ustymukhman/face-masking

:sunglasses: Real-time webcam face masking :alien:

face-api face-detection face-mask face-masking face-tracking shaders threejs webgl

Last synced: 13 Feb 2025

https://github.com/smileysunshinesky/3d_portfolio

3D web developer portfolio

react reactjs threejs

Last synced: 01 Dec 2024

https://github.com/smileysunshinesky/iphone

Recreate the Apple iPhone 15 Pro website, combining GSAP animations and Three.js 3D effects. From custom animations to animated 3D models, this tutorial covers it all.

gsap nextjs nextjs14 threejs

Last synced: 01 Dec 2024

https://github.com/sokhuong-uon/t4rn

Turborepo, Typescript, Three.js, Tailwind CSS, React Three Fiber, Next.js Template

3d creative-coding nextjs r3f react tailwindcss threejs turborepo typescript

Last synced: 24 Jan 2025

https://github.com/shotmeow/iphone16-present

Recreate the Apple iPhone 16 website, combining Framer Motion animations and Three.js 3D effects.

accessibility apple framer-motion iphone nextjs react responsive swiper tailwindcss threejs web website

Last synced: 11 Jan 2025

https://github.com/ethanlchristensen/threejs_game_of_life

2D and 3D web-based Game of Life visualizer using threeJS

game gameoflife simulation threejs

Last synced: 19 Nov 2024

https://github.com/bhpcv252/webgl-img-particle-carousel-exp

WebGL image particles fade-in carousel

carousel image particles shaders threejs webgl

Last synced: 17 Jan 2025

https://github.com/michaelkolesidis/fintech-world

An immersive 3D gamification web platform that promotes, educates, and informs visitors about digital payment solutions, through a fun and engaging experience.

3d-game fintech game gamification gamified island open-world summer threejs threejs-game web-game

Last synced: 11 Jan 2025

https://github.com/dbkaplun/three-snapshot-serializer

Jest snapshot serializer for THREE objects

json serializer snapshot threejs

Last synced: 03 Jan 2025

https://github.com/neel-dandiwala/spacex-dragon2-ui

This is an interactive mock-up of the SpaceX Dragon 2 spacecraft's user interface. It contains 5 panels and multiple amusing features. A front-end project made using Vue 3.

dragon frontend javascript spacex threejs vue vue3 webgl

Last synced: 26 Dec 2024

https://github.com/laszlokorte/svelte-rust-fft

Discrete Fourier Transform in Svelte+ThreeJS+Rust+WASM

dft fft frft signal-processing svelte threejs

Last synced: 26 Dec 2024

https://github.com/am4nn/portfolio-nextjs-website

Switching to Nextjs:14, Typescript, Tailwind, Framer-Motion and Three.js, with serverless API integration for seamless communication

framer-motion nextjs14 reactjs rest-api tailwindcss threejs typescript

Last synced: 30 Jan 2025

https://github.com/andrewisen-tikab/three-spatial-hash-grid

A performant Spatial Hash Grid for three.js

spatial-hash-grid threejs

Last synced: 13 Feb 2025

https://github.com/iondrimba/madcaps

🎨 Playing with Matcaps and Threejs

3d animation codepen creative-coding demo javascript matcap motion threejs

Last synced: 13 Feb 2025

https://github.com/sawa-zen/utsuroi

The plugin makes it easy to control model animation when use Three.js :)

animation plugin threejs

Last synced: 13 Feb 2025

https://github.com/jgphilpott/blackbox

An airplane simulator using a Raspberry Pi with a Sense HAT.

aerospace aviation raspberry-pi robotics sense-hat threejs

Last synced: 10 Feb 2025

https://github.com/oguzhan18/3d-model-designer

3D Model Designer - a revolutionary Angular application that empowers you to create, manipulate, and customize 3D models effortlessly. With an intuitive interface and advanced Three.js integration, this tool is perfect for both beginners and seasoned professionals in the field of 3D modeling.

angular threejs threejs-model

Last synced: 18 Nov 2024

https://github.com/linkzy3471/3d-solar-system-model

A simple 3D solar system model based on Three.js.

js nasa threejs web

Last synced: 13 Feb 2025

https://github.com/smrghsh/butterfly

lots of butterflies! immersive/cross platform computer graphics

art generative particles threejs webgl

Last synced: 15 Nov 2024

https://github.com/hanzopgp/cvportfolioweb

This is my interactive online portfolio and CV.

p5js personal portfolio resume threejs web

Last synced: 16 Jan 2025

https://github.com/moklick/covid19-deaths-visualization

A walkable 3D visualization of covid-19 deaths worldwide

3d-visualization coronavirus covid-19 three-fiber threejs

Last synced: 23 Jan 2025

https://github.com/sesto-dev/sesto.dev

🌠 Portfolio website built with Next.js and Tailwind CSS

nextjs portfolio react react-three-fiber tailwindcss threejs

Last synced: 28 Nov 2024

https://github.com/rui-exe/spacetennis

A three.js 3d scene of a tennis court in a distant moon.

3d-graphics graphics javascript space tennis threejs

Last synced: 01 Jan 2025

https://github.com/qc20/polygonplayground

An interactive 3D physics playground where polygons come to life, blending design and technology in a captivating simulation.

3d-graphics cannonjs creative-coding data-visualization educational-tool frontend-development generative-art geometry interactive-design javascript physics-simulation threejs user-experience-design web-animation webgl

Last synced: 31 Dec 2024

https://github.com/yenilikci/cshow-three-fiber

With React 18.2, a 3D car show scene developed using React Three Fiber is included. Please check the documentation page of PMND to learn more about React Three Fiber. You can support the education source by the YouTube user named Irradiance730.

car-show educational-project extended react-three-drei react-three-fiber react-three-postprocessing react18 threejs

Last synced: 17 Jan 2025

https://github.com/marcelo-schreiber/3d-sort

Visualizador de algoritmos de ordenação em 3d.

3dsort algorithms pwa react sort three-fiber threejs

Last synced: 25 Dec 2024

https://github.com/tomashubelbauer/three-op-1

An OP-1 model in ThreeJS

op-1 op1 teenage-engineering threejs webgl

Last synced: 31 Dec 2024

https://github.com/cheng500/react-animated-cubes

3D Cube Edges background animation

animated background cubes react threejs

Last synced: 13 Feb 2025

https://github.com/artbit/lenticular-sticker

Simple demo of the lenticular sticker effect using THREE.js

3d html5 lenticular-effect threejs

Last synced: 16 Nov 2024

https://github.com/m-foskett/3d-animation-viewer

3D Animation Viewer made with Vite, Three.js, Mantine and TypeScript

mantine-ui threejs typescript vite

Last synced: 23 Dec 2024

https://github.com/maayanlab/l1000fwd

Large-scale visualization of drug-induced transcriptomic signatures

data-visualization drug-discovery threejs

Last synced: 21 Nov 2024

https://github.com/cvalenzuela/bode.ga

A 24-hour web documentary that captures the everyday interactions and transactions of a small bodega in Queens, NY.

bodega documentary photogrammetry threejs

Last synced: 12 Jan 2025

https://github.com/rajyo/portfolio2.0

Developed a responsive portfolio web application using Next.js, Tailwind CSS, Framer Motion, Three.js and used Aceternity UI, Shadcn UI for building amazing UI components.

aceternity-ui framer-motion nextjs shadcn-ui tailwindcss threejs typescript zod

Last synced: 23 Dec 2024

https://github.com/caioliveira277/learning-threejs

Projetos básicos para aprender threejs

3d-graphics threejs typescript webgl

Last synced: 23 Jan 2025

https://github.com/hanmag/geov.js

GIS visualization based on Three.js and WebGL.

gis threejs tilemap

Last synced: 25 Dec 2024

https://github.com/hackemateninja/threephoenix

Experimental things with Phoenix Live View hooks and Three.js

phoenix phoenix-elixir phoenix-framework phoenix-liveview threejs

Last synced: 07 Feb 2025

https://github.com/themarvellousteam/the-marvellous-drunken-sailor

:skull: Global Game Jam 2018

ggj ggj2018 threejs

Last synced: 26 Dec 2024

https://github.com/yufengjie97/learning-threejs

learning threejs

threejs typescript

Last synced: 10 Jan 2025

https://github.com/guillaume-gomez/fromimage2geometries

convert an image to 3d shapes

computer-art react threejs

Last synced: 05 Feb 2025

https://github.com/ascender1729/quantumwaste

A Quantum-Inspired Molecular Recycling Simulator utilizing quantum algorithms and machine learning to optimize polymer recycling.

flask machine-learning polymer-recycling quantum-algorithms quantum-computing reactjs scikit-learn sustainable-technology threejs

Last synced: 06 Feb 2025

https://github.com/baues/building-editor-react

React wrapper for building-editor

bim building-editor react threejs webgl

Last synced: 01 Jan 2025

https://github.com/sanchez3/burnshader

WebGL ShaderMaterial

material threejs

Last synced: 31 Dec 2024

https://github.com/dariush-hassani/my-web

A 3D Web Site using Three.js and React.

react reactjs threejs

Last synced: 23 Jan 2025

https://github.com/jungdu/marquee3d

Threejs를 활용한 3D 공간에서 여러 개의 이미지를 전시하기 위한 UI

threejs typescript

Last synced: 23 Jan 2025

https://github.com/blindbyte98/astro

ASTRO is a realistic 3D procedural star system simulator that offers immersive exploration of celestial mechanics using scientifically accurate models.

3d 3d-graphics astronomy astrophysics computer-graphics educational html javascript open-source physics procedural-generation rendering research science scientific-research simulation space threejs visualization web-development

Last synced: 13 Feb 2025

https://github.com/omerdogan3/project1-gui

Design Patterns Project1 Extra - GUI Front End Project

client-side javascript jquery planet threejs vanilla-javascript webgl

Last synced: 06 Feb 2025

https://github.com/bibhushankarki/3d-protfolio-animation

Portfolio website design with Three.js - a tool for building amazing 3D graphics with JavaScript.

3d 3d-animation geometry material portfolio-design texture threejs

Last synced: 18 Nov 2024

https://github.com/lucamueller1/three-tween-path

Uses TweenJs to create a Catmull-Rom curve to move a 3d object along. Can be used to pause between several paths.

catmull-rom pathfinding splines threejs tween tweenjs

Last synced: 12 Jan 2025

https://github.com/cookeem/threejs-webpack-demo

Three.js and webpack4 demo

es6 three-js threejs webpack4

Last synced: 25 Nov 2024

https://github.com/airingursb/music-visualization

H5 音乐可视化

threejs web-audio-api

Last synced: 12 Jan 2025

https://github.com/k0rventen/planetarium-webgl

A cool planetarium, using webGL tech.

imawebdev planetarium threejs webgl

Last synced: 23 Jan 2025

https://github.com/deikairru/demarqueirru

Free version. Template used on deikairru portfolio website. The full version included full animation, game interactivity, built-in blog, metadata SEO, and custom CMS. Contact for more info.

nextjs14 personal-website portfolio responsive-design tailwind-css template threejs typescript

Last synced: 13 Feb 2025

https://github.com/persanix-llc/chatrpi-app

Chat for Raspberry Pi (Chatrpi) is a voice assistant for the Raspberry Pi that can hold simple conversations and control GPIO output.

raspberrypi speech-recognition speech-synthesis tensorflowjs threejs voice-assistant

Last synced: 03 Jan 2025

https://github.com/ushliypakostnik/dune-three

Browser strategy on Three

stylus threejs typescript vue3

Last synced: 15 Nov 2024

https://github.com/n3rdium/webcraft

A web terrain generator written in Three.js.

css game html javascript minecraft opensource threejs

Last synced: 13 Feb 2025

https://github.com/parking-master/fps3

This is FPS3, the ultrarealistic version of FPS with an amazing amount of graphics and performance.

css fps fps-game fps-shooter gametime html html-css-javascript javascript javascript-game pubnub threejs web-game

Last synced: 22 Nov 2024

https://github.com/schroedinger-hat/xmas-crystal-ball-threejs

A Xmas 2020 easter egg with some crystal ball made in Three.js

360-sphere threejs virtual-reality vr xmas-lights xmas2020

Last synced: 22 Jan 2025

https://github.com/eronne/threejs-audio-visualizer

🔊 An audio visualizer using Three.js & shaders 🔊

javascript javascript-library shaders threejs webaudio-api

Last synced: 05 Feb 2025

https://github.com/sinclairzx81/merc

blender scene renderer demo

controller-api threejs webgl

Last synced: 02 Feb 2025